Increasing float precision and matrix precision through the engine's options could yeild improvements. Testing is needed.

@BarthPaleologue
Copy link
Owner Author

Using high precision matrices improves the visual quality, the gap is less visible.

To remove it completely, a chunk skirt will be needed.
